A frame tent is a type of temporary structure designed for outdoor events, featuring a sturdy framework made of metal or aluminum. This design allows for greater flexibility in placement since the tent does not require center poles, maximizing the usable space underneath. Typically used for weddings, parties, and corporate events, frame tents can be easily set up on various surfaces, including concrete or grass. The tent's fabric cover is tensioned over the frame, providing a clean, elegant appearance. Additionally, frame tents are available in various sizes and styles, making them suitable for different occasions and environments. Their robust construction ensures stability even in windy conditions, making them a reliable choice for outdoor gatherings.
A Frame Tent stands out from a Pole Tent primarily due to its structural design. It utilizes a rigid frame made of metal or aluminum that supports the tent's canopy, allowing for a completely open interior without obstructions from poles. This feature makes it ideal for events where space optimization is crucial, as it allows for more flexible layout options. In contrast, a Pole Tent relies on center poles and side poles to support the fabric, which can limit usable space and create obstructions within the tent. Additionally, Frame Tents can be set up on various surfaces, including hard ground, making them versatile for a range of outdoor locations, whereas Pole Tents typically require stakes for proper installation.
Frame tents are typically constructed using a combination of durable materials designed to withstand various weather conditions. The frame is usually made from aluminum or steel, providing strength and stability. These materials are lightweight yet robust, making it easier to assemble and disassemble the tents. The canopy is generally crafted from polyethylene or vinyl, both of which are waterproof and UV-resistant. Polyethylene is often used for its affordability and lightweight nature, while vinyl offers higher durability and resistance to punctures and tears. Together, these materials ensure that frame tents are both functional and resilient for outdoor events.
1. Prepare the Area
Start by selecting a flat, level ground for the frame tent. Clear any debris and ensure the space is free of sharp objects that could damage the tent.
2. Assemble the Frame
Lay out all the frame components and connect the vertical poles to the horizontal beams. Ensure that all parts fit together securely to create a stable structure.
3. Erect the Tent
Stand the assembled frame upright and carefully position it in the designated area. It may require additional help to lift the frame into place.
4. Attach the Fabric
Drape the tent fabric over the frame, ensuring it is evenly distributed. Secure the fabric to the frame using the provided clips or straps to maintain stability.
5. Secure the Tent
Use stakes and guy lines to anchor the tent firmly to the ground. This step is crucial for preventing movement or damage during wind or inclement weather.
6. Final Adjustments
Check for any sagging or loose areas and adjust the fabric and frame as necessary. Ensure that all components are tight and secure for optimal performance.
Frame tents come in a variety of sizes to accommodate different event needs. They typically range from small, intimate sizes, such as 10x10 feet, suitable for small gatherings or vendor booths, to larger options like 40x100 feet, which can host significant events like weddings or corporate functions. The flexibility in sizing allows for customization based on the space available and the number of attendees. Additionally, frame tents can be combined to create larger setups, making them versatile for various occasions.
